In early September, nearly half of the state of Spiders plans to go on strike against poor working conditions at the studio. Specifically, developers are unhappy with low wages, inefficient management, and issues with the production of GreedFall II. In a statement to the media, Spiders’ leaders denied these accusations.

The managers described the claims of the disgruntled employees as false, defamatory, and not reflecting the true situation at the studio, and labeled the open letter published by the strikers as an attempt to harm Spiders' reputation.

Spiders’ leaders stated that over the past few days, they have repeatedly tried to meet with a delegation of employees, but have been unsuccessful. They plan to organize another meeting by the end of this week.

The leaders of Spiders also noted that the GreedFall II team is “enthusiastically” preparing the game for its early access release on September 24. In their letter, the strikers claimed that the work on GreedFall II had reached a standstill, and the developers themselves were burned out and doubtful about the quality of the project.
